Re: [BackupPC-users] Mounting synology NAS breaks Backuppc
2014-09-25 08:54:57
Thanks for the heads up Phil, think that did the trick!
A combination of your advice about the nolock option and this post
(http://www.ryananddebi.com/2013/01/15/linuxmint-or-ubuntu-how-to-automount-synology-shares/)
got me a working setup. No need to match UID etc.
<NAS IP>:/volume5/LinuxBackups /var/lib/backuppc nfs rw,hard,intr,nolock 0 0
Thanks for the prompt replies all round. Hopefully others with similar
issues will find the above useful.
regards, Tom
